Why the map you grew up with disagrees

On a Mercator map, area grows with distance from the equator. Guernsey sits at about 49°N and is stretched to 2.37× its true area; Jordan at 31° N is stretched to 1.37×. That difference is why Guernsey looks so much bigger than it is next to Jordan. The figure above uses the Equal Earth projection, where every square kilometre is drawn the same size.
